Abstract

A network, such as a network on chip, includes a plurality of levels of switches organized in a hierarchy. The connections between the switches are constituted by connections which are able to transport packets of information in opposite directions in such a way that one switch, or one process associated thereto, can send or receive packets in the framework of the network along one and the same path, constituted by an ascending stretch, in which the packet goes up the network hierarchy as far as a root switch common to the source and to the destination, and a descending stretch in which the packet goes down the network hierarchy towards the destination. A routing logic is provided, configured for defining the routing path in a non-adaptive way, selecting the ascending stretch according to the source and the descending stretch according to the destination, irrespective of the traffic of the packets.
